Are impact ratings random?

Source: http://www.nia.nih.gov/research/blog/2014/01/are-impact-ratings-random

With paylines being what they are at NIA and NIH, we tend to hear that discriminating among applications in the narrow range of scores represented by the top 20 percent of applications reviewed by the Center for Scientific Review is a lottery. Surely, it is too much to ask of peer review to discriminate reasonably among applications of such quality. So what sense, then, in drawing a payline? Why not hold a lottery instead? Or at least allow program and senior Institute staff considerable discretion in selecting priorities for award among this set….

Omega-3 fatty acids from fish oil, aid healing after heart attack

Source: http://www.brainhealtheducation.org/omega-3-fatty-acids-from-fish-oil-aid-healing-after-heart-attack/?utm_source=rss&utm_medium=rss&utm_campaign=omega-3-fatty-acids-from-fish-oil-aid-healing-after-heart-attack

Giving heart attack patients a high dose of omega-3 fatty acids from fish oil, daily for six months after a heart attack improved the function of the heart and reduced scarring in the undamaged muscle, according to new research in the American Heart Association’s journal Circulation. The heart’s shape and function can be altered after a
